JPE seeks mass action versus abusive telcos |
|
By Efren L. Danao, Senior Reporter
Senate President Juan Ponce Enrile called Tuesday on all consumers
with “disappearing” pre-paid loads in their cell phones to lodge
their complaints in his office so the Senate could draft remedial
legislation to protect them. Enrile said in a privileged speech that
the day after newspapers came out with a report on his disappearing
prepaid load, he received a “flood of calls and texts” from
alleged victims of the same thing.

Anti-Dynasty bill gets Senate panel endorsement,
puts 12 lawmakers on notice
|
|
The bill prohibiting the establishment of political dynasties in the
country has been passed at the committee level in the Senate without
any amendment and endorsed for plenary deliberations.
